Output d37c5c9161826cc8f9694d953af7757efd2a211045b92aa650abd7608bad6924:27

value
180742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434a33b3b54fed32dcbea0011a7e92ba078920f0 OP_EQUAL
address
37pp63DWcNWpZHehAz95TKXLRmuQRcn1R1
transaction
d37c5c9161826cc8f9694d953af7757efd2a211045b92aa650abd7608bad6924
spent
true